| Description: |  | This invention is an addition to an ordinary brace to provide gearing. It required a second set of hands to hold the accessory while the first set of hands operated the brace. The one known example, pictured in the second photo, is equipped with a chuck made by Millers Falls Co. It is not known if this was manufactured in any quantity, and if so, by whom. |  |
